Uses of OBD Readers
OBD Readers are used to find the amount of emission from the engine of the vehicle. OBD refers to On-Board Diagnostics. At initial stage it is used for checking emission amount only. But later on, improvement in technology has made the OBD readers to get the real time data from the engine. They have to be just plugged in, so that they will get connected to the computer of the vehicle. Then they will send data that can be used to do the complete diagnostics of the status of the engine.
The vehicles that came before 1996 used OBD 1 readers. These readers have codes and definition that differ from one manufacture to another. Now the vehicles are using OBD 2 readers. These readers have standard codes and definitions. Most of the OBD 1 reader vehicles are not compatible with OBD 2 readers.
OBD reader came as a boon to the vehicle owners and also the mechanics. Since it provides the real time data about the engine, the mechanic can use this data to fix the problem accurately. The time taken to find the problem and its solution will also get reduced drastically. This avoids looking into the parts that are not related to the problem. The OBD readers can be connected to the computer. This will give the detailed report of the engine such as temperature of the engine, pressure of oil, tachometer, speed. So with that the user can diagnose the problem. Unless it is a serious problem, the user can solve it himself without going to the mechanic. This will save the user large amount of money.
OBD readers will return the data in the form of codes. These DTC – Diagnostic Trouble Codes will be in the form of alpha numeric. They can be interrupted with the help of code dictionaries to find the problem. Problems related to the throttle sensor, oxygen sensor, temperature sensor can be diagnosed by OBD reader and it will send signal. Before replacement of any part the data should be analyzed carefully with the help of computer. Because sometimes the OBD readers will send signal due to some bad sensor problems.
OBD scanners are more versatile when compared with OBD readers. The reason is that the OBD scanners will give the codes and also the describing statements of the codes. But OBD readers will give only the codes that the user has to match with the list of codes available to find the description of the problem. OBD scanners are available as hand held devices.
